  3. Mike, This is a cool project .And I like where you are going with it. Over here in the Philippines . There are lots of these type of "mini" trucks. They are called multicabs. As the can be found with all types of bodies on them . From your single cab pick up, to a double cab pick up a van, doub;e cab van w/small pick up box on the back, And of course what is called a jeepney style or multicab mini bus type vehicle. That is a major from of transportation throughout Asia . I am not 100% sure but I don't know if you can buy a brand new one here. Due to import regulations and Customs duties. They ship used vehicles of this type and others from Japan , Korea etc That are disassembled , and that are rebuilt here in the Philippines. This in itself is a big business. As for the crash test. Just let me say." You do not want to be in one in any type of crash, but especially a head on crash ". And If you are a person with a wide body or are over say 6' tall you will be extremely uncomfortable in one. All this said they are robust vehicle that seem to do the job. Be Well Gator
